Abstract
In this paper, by using fixed-point methods, we study the existence and uniqueness of a solution for the nonlinear fractional differential equation boundary-value problem D(alpha)u(t) = f(t, u(t)) with a Riemann-Liouville fractional derivative via the different boundary-value problems u(0) = u(T), and the three-point boundary condition u(0)= beta(1)u(eta) and u(T) = beta(2)u(eta), where T > 0, t is an element of I = [0, T], 0 < alpha < 1, 0 < eta < T, 0 < beta(1) < beta(2) < 1.
